Context for the sync: the 2pm same-day cutoff for Butterhollow bakery orders is enforced in the ordering service, and every deploy that touches the cutoff logic must carry traceable provenance. We record the source revision, the build environment digest, and the attestation from the signing step, so anyone can reconstruct exactly which binary enforced which cutoff on a given day. This page is updated after each release. The current release's provenance token appears directly beneath this paragraph.

session token of tajef-bageg = htk21_5d90d574934f3ccae6437

**Mgmt Meeting Minutes — Retiring the Brightline Range**

Quick recap for sales leads at Fenholt Supplies: we agreed to retire the Brightline fixture range by year-end. Remaining stock moves to clearance pricing next month, and accounts on standing orders get migrated to the Lumetta range. Trade-in incentives were approved in principle. The confidential note on next steps sits just below.

board note of bajof-bajeg: The pricing group signed off on a budget of $13.4 million for Project Sildor. The renewal with Lamixek Holdings closes at $48.9 million a year, 49 percent above the last contract.

The Cartquill webhook retries too aggressively when carriers return 5xx. Plugin authors relying on at-most-once delivery will see duplicates. Switch to jittered exponential backoff and honor the dedupe header. Also cap payload size — some carriers send full scan history. The retry and batching constants I'm proposing are these.

tuning constants:
QUOTAS = {
    "quenael": 10,
    "oliwyn": 1,
}

Account recovery for Scorchline, our GPU memory profiler: if your dashboard login dies (happens after the quarterly cert swap), don't re-register — you'll orphan your trace history. Instead, hit the recovery flow and pick "existing maintainer." When it asks for the team credential, use the passphrase printed just below this paragraph.

unlock words, hahip-baduf: holwyn-istath-julvan